So, why should you, guys, care about pharmacodynamic endpoints? Because they are the *unsung heroes* of getting safe and effective medicines to market! Think about it: a drug can look promising in a petri dish, but how do we know it will actually *do* something good inside a living, breathing person? That's where pharmacodynamic endpoints shine. They provide the *objective evidence* we need. They help us understand if a drug is hitting its target, how strongly it's hitting it, and what that impact is on the body. This is absolutely vital for determining the correct dosage. Too little drug, and you won't see any meaningful pharmacodynamic endpoint changes, meaning the drug won't work. Too much drug, and you might see exaggerated effects, leading to dangerous side effects – a whole other set of undesirable pharmacodynamic endpoints, if you will! By carefully monitoring these endpoints in clinical trials, researchers can pinpoint the 'sweet spot' – the dose that provides the desired therapeutic effect with minimal risk. Furthermore, pharmacodynamic endpoints are key to understanding a drug's mechanism of action. How exactly is this new cancer drug killing tumor cells? This helps refine the drug, potentially leading to better versions or combination therapies. Imagine a drug designed to reduce inflammation. A pharmacodynamic endpoint might be a decrease in specific inflammatory markers in the blood. If we see that decrease, we know the drug is interacting with the inflammatory pathway as planned. If we *don't* see it, even if patients report feeling a bit better (which can sometimes be placebo effect, guys!), we have a problem. The drug might not be working the way we thought, or maybe it needs to be combined with something else. These endpoints are also incredibly useful for comparing different drugs. If two drugs aim to achieve the same outcome, say lowering cholesterol, comparing their pharmacodynamic endpoints (like the percentage reduction in LDL cholesterol) gives us a clear, quantitative way to see which one is more effective. It moves us beyond subjective reports and into the realm of hard data. Ultimately, pharmacodynamic endpoints empower us to make *evidence-based decisions* about a drug's potential. They are the foundation of good science and the reason we can trust the medicines we rely on.
